Chimpanzee Trekking in Nyungwe Forest
Begin before dawn for an exhilarating chimpanzee trekking experience in Nyungwe Forest. Your guide will lead you through misty forest trails in search of one of the park's 13 chimpanzee groups. The trek combines physical challenge with the reward of observing these intelligent primates in their natural habitat. You'll also encounter other primates, including colobus monkeys and various bird species. Return to your lodge for rest and afternoon relaxation, with optional guided nature walks or canopy walks available.

Mountain Gorilla Trekking - The Highlight
This is the pinnacle of your safari experience. Start before dawn and hike through misty cloud forests of Volcanoes National Park in search of mountain gorillas. Your experienced guide will track gorilla groups using signs and vocalizations. Upon finding a gorilla family, you'll have a magical hour observing these magnificent creatures in their natural habitat—an experience described as life-changing by most visitors. The trek combines physical exertion with profound emotional reward. Return to your lodge for celebration dinner, reflecting on this unforgettable encounter.

Volcanoes National Park Exploration
Enjoy a leisurely morning to recover from yesterday's trek. Explore additional attractions in Volcanoes National Park, such as the volcanic crater lakes, hiking to Bisoke volcano summit, or visiting the Dian Fossey Gorilla Fund research center to learn about gorilla conservation efforts. Alternatively, enjoy a guided nature walk through secondary forests or visit local Batwa communities to experience their traditional culture and way of life. This day offers flexibility to customize your experience based on interests and energy levels.
